Python自定义函数库:便捷封装满足日常开发需求

需积分: 11 0 下载量 96 浏览量 更新于2024-11-15 收藏 5KB ZIP 举报
资源摘要信息: "python_library是一个自定义的Python函数库,其设计理念是追求简单实用,旨在封装那些开发者在日常工作中经常使用的函数。这个库的核心理念可以概括为“简单、简单、简单”,意味着库中的每个函数都会尽量做到易于理解和使用,同时满足最基本的功能需求。此外,库的设计目标是方便快捷,即通过预定义的函数集来加速日常开发流程,减少重复劳动和基础代码的编写。该库主要服务于对Python编程有实际需求的用户,尤其是希望提高工作效率的开发人员。 在Python开发中,经常会有一些功能模块被频繁使用,而这些功能往往不是标准库的一部分,或者在标准库中实现起来较为复杂。为了解决这一问题,程序员可能会自定义函数库来封装这些功能,以便重用。'python_library'正是这样一个自定义库,它可能包含但不限于以下几类功能: 1. 数据处理:例如,数据清洗、格式化、转换等通用数据操作功能,可以简化数据预处理的代码。 2. 文件操作:封装文件读写、目录遍历、文件压缩解压等操作,使得文件处理更加模块化和可重用。 3. 网络请求:简化网络请求的封装,例如GET和POST请求,以及JSON等数据格式的处理。 4. 时间日期:提供时间日期的计算、格式化、解析等函数,方便处理与时间相关的逻辑。 5. 调试工具:增加日志记录、异常捕获等辅助调试功能,提高开发和测试的效率。 6. 其他辅助功能:根据具体需求,可能还会包括正则表达式处理、加密解密等辅助性的工具函数。 由于'python_library'是一个自建的函数库,开发者在使用时可能需要遵循一定的规范和文档说明来正确引入和使用这些函数。一些库可能使用pip安装,而自建库则可能需要从源代码进行安装,例如通过执行setup.py文件或直接将库文件放置于项目的工作目录下。自建库在版本更新和维护上可能不如官方或第三方库规范,因此开发者需要关注作者的更新日志或文档来了解新版本带来的变化和新功能。 在实际使用中,开发者可能需要根据个人或团队的需求,对'python_library'进行适当的定制化修改和扩展,以确保其功能能够满足特定场景下的使用要求。这种自定义性质的函数库,一方面提高了开发效率,另一方面也促进了代码的复用,有助于构建更加高效、清晰的代码结构。"